Path Traversal in Ultimate Member
CVE-2018-0586
Directory traversal vulnerability in the shortcodes function of Ultimate Member plugin prior to version 2.0.4 for WordPress allows remote authenticated attackers to read arbitrary files via unspecified vectors.
Vulnerability class: Path Traversal (Directory Traversal)
EPSS: 0.016 (73.4th percentile) — read the EPSS interpretation.
CVSS v3 metric
CVSS v3 base score 4.3 (Medium). Vector: CVSS:3.0/AV:N/AC:L/PR:L/UI:N/S:U/C:L/I:N/A:N.
Affected products
- Ultimate Member — versions prior to version 2.0.4
- Ultimatemember User_profile_\&_membership
